The AF’s are the better of the two but as Mule Deer wrote, avoid shooting into an eland‘s shoulder. The knuckle of the front leg is very tough as well. I wouldn’t use the Accubond.

I would rather have a .30 168 TTSX @ 2850 than anything you mention. Remember, if you hit it you pay for it regardless of the outcome. My experience is that the LR guys decide to shoot within 250 yards or so when faced with this financial reality.
